Re: git can not access remote repository anymore after cygwin+git update


On Thu, Oct 19, 2017, at 14:28, Marco Atzeri wrote:
> On 19/10/2017 13:38, Ronald Fischer wrote:
> > I'm using 64 Bit Cygwin on Windows 7. After upgrading Git to version
> > 2.14.2 (I think I had 2.13 or 2.12 before), git can not access our
> > repository anymore. Commands such as "git pull" or "git push" result
> > into the error
> > 
> > 
> > fatal: Could not read from remote repository.
> > Please make sure you have the correct access rights
> > and the repository exists.

> it seems your cygwin package was not update correctly:
> 
> cygwin                     2.9.0-3                      OK
> 
> but
> 
>   3238k 2017/04/01 C:\cygwin64\bin\cygwin1.dll - os=4.0 img=0.0 sys=5.2
>                    "cygwin1.dll" v0.0 ts=2017-04-01 20:47
> Cygwin DLL version info:
>          DLL version: 2.8.0
> 
> May be is not the root cause but you should reinstall the package
> with no running process. 


This was it! Thanks a lot!!!
